Course Details

RF Propagation Fundamentals: Understanding of radio frequency (RF) propagation principles, including free space path loss, frequency selective fading, and multipath propagation.
Maritime Communication Systems: Overview of communication systems used in maritime applications, including GMDSS, AIS, and VSAT.
Maritime Propagation Channel Characterization: Analysis of maritime propagation channels, including sea state, rain attenuation, and atmospheric ducting.
Antenna Design for Maritime Applications: Design and implementation of antennas for maritime communication systems, including yagi, log periodic, and patch antennas.
RF System Design for Maritime Applications: Design and optimization of RF systems for maritime communication, including link budget, diversity techniques, and system integration.
Maritime Satellite Communication: Overview of satellite communication systems used in maritime applications, including Inmarsat, Iridium, and Globalstar.
Maritime MIMO Systems: Study of multiple-input multiple-output (MIMO) systems for maritime communication, including spatial multiplexing, space-time coding, and beamforming.
Maritime Network Security: Security considerations for maritime communication networks, including encryption, authentication, and access control.
Maritime Communication Regulations and Standards: Overview of communication regulations and standards for maritime applications, including IMO, ITU, and IEC.
